Scratchの次はIchigoJam

ねぇチョコ、このIchigoJamってやつ
おもしろいよ!
いちごジャム?
おいしいの?
ぼくのパンにもつけてよー!
違う違う!
プログラミングのIchigoJamのことだよ!


このブログの内容


IchigoJamとは?

IchigoJam


手のひらにのせられる大きさの、プログラミング専用こどもパソコンです。
IchigoJamにテレビとキーボードをつなげば、すぐにプログラミングを始められます。
インターネットへの接続や難しい設定は必要ありません。

引用:IchigoJam公式HP
- IchigoJamとは
URL:https://ichigojam.net/

初心者向けと言われるプログラミング言語BASIC(ベーシック)が体験できます。
本体は緑色の基板と呼ばれる板。


はんだ付けの電子工作からできるキットや、完成済みの基板、キーボードやケーブルのセットを購入することも可能。
いちごに合わせた可愛いセットも!

引用:IchigoJam公式HP
- 購入ページ
URL:https://ichigojam.net/




こちらにも、ノートパソコンのようなセットや、小さなデスクトップパソコンのようなセットもあり、欲しくなっちゃいます!

引用:PCNプログラミングクラブネットワーク公式HP
- 製品(個人)ページ
- Category
- IchigoDake
URL:https://pcn.club/


ViscuitやScratchとの違い

Viscuit(ビスケット)やScratch(スクラッチ)はやったことがありますか?

簡単に言うと、図形化されたパーツを組み合わせることでプログラミングできる言語です。


文字をキーボードで打つのが難しかったり、英語、アルファベットが分からなかったりする子ども向けに開発されています。
ドラッグ&ドロップで簡単にプログラミングができます。
(私の小さい頃はなかった…。うらやましい)


そのため、子どもたちが遊んで学ぶ最初のプログラミング言語として選ばれています。



でも、大人の世界でプログラミングと言うとちょっと違う。


英語に似たコードをルールに合わせて書いてプログラミングします。

本格的にプログラミングをしたいと思ったら、そういった言語を学ぶ必要があります。



もし、ViscuitやScratchでプログラミングを楽しめているのなら、コードを書く方のプログラミングもきっと楽しめます。

子どもたちがキーボードやアルファベットに慣れてきたようなら、次へステップアップ!
タイピングゲームをしていたり、チャットを使っていたりしたらチャンス!

Minecraft(マインクラフト)でコマンドを打ち始めたらIchigoJamにも挑戦!






なぜ次はIchigoJamがいいの?

IchigoJamは初心者向けと言われるBASIC言語です。
BASICはやりたいことを順番に書いていきます。
なので、書いてあるコードで何をしているのか、初心者でも理解しやすいのです。

また、前提として必要な知識が少なく、すぐに書き始めることができます。
IchigoJamBASICはコマンドが100個だけ!

他の言語だと本一冊でますが、IchigoJamBASICは紙一枚。

引用:IchigoJam公式HP
- 説明書・読み物ページ
- 使い方
- BASICリファレンス ver 1.4
URL:https://ichigojam.net/





何よりも…、

子どもたちが挑戦してすぐに挫折してしまったらもったいない。

なるべく簡単な言語で小さな成功体験を積むべきです。

子どもたちには、コードを書くプログラミングの楽しさを味わってもらいたい!



IchigoJamBASICを始めよう!



購入しなくてもできる?

じゃぁ今から一緒にやろう!
待って待って?
基板とか持ってないよ?
大丈夫、WEBでもできるよ!

実は、IchigoJamにはWEB上でプログラミングできるサイトがあります。


引用:IchigoJam web公式HP
URL:https://fukuno.jig.jp/app/IchigoJam/

WEBなので、基板がなくてもパソコンがあればプログラミングが可能です。
スマホでもできますが、入力が大変なのでパソコンでやりましょう。
(挑戦しましたがウギャーとなり諦めました)


ただし、音を鳴らすプログラムはパソコンの音が出なかったり、プログラムの保存(SAVE)もどうやらできなそう。

追記)音を鳴らすのできました!
「AUDIO ON」というボタンがありました!


このように一部の機能には基板のセットが必要なようです。
本当にIchigoJamを楽しむためには基板があったほうがいいですね。


WEBと基板の違い

WEBと基板の違いを整理しておきます。

 WEB 

  • 手持ちのパソコンでプログラミングができる
  • ネット接続必要
  • 音や保存(SAVE)など一部の機能の動作確認はできない

子どもが使えるパソコンがある。
基板や組み立ての勉強は不要でBASICの勉強ができれば良い。
子どもにさせる前に大人がBASICを学んでみたい。

パソコンで始めよう!



 基板 

  • キーボードやテレビなどのモニターにつなげばプログラミンができる
  • ネット接続不要

子ども用のパソコンがない。
子ども専用BASICプログラミングマシンを用意したい。
WEBで楽しんで、もっとIchigoJamを楽しみたくなった。
基板とかも触らせたい、触りたい。組み立てたい。

基板セットを買おう!


おわりに

そもそも今、半導体不足の影響で買えないセットもありますね…。
ここまで書いておいてなんですが、私もまだ持っていません。
子どもたちがまだ小さいので、小学生になったら買いたいです!


ひとまず今は大人の私がやってみます。
次回は手持ちのパソコンでIchigoJamに挑戦です!




※IchigoJamはjig.jpの登録商標です。

この記事をシェアする
  No Related Posts...

0 件のコメント :

コメントを投稿